Electrical safety

Be sure the appliance is properly installed and grounded by a qualified technician.

The appliance should be serviced only by qualified service personnel. Repairs carried out by unqualified individuals may cause injury or serious malfunction. If your appliance is in need of repair, contact your local service centre.. Failure to follow these instructions may result in damage and void the warranty..

Flush - mounted appliances may be operated only after they have been installed in cabinets and workplaces that conform to the relevant standards. This ensures sufficient protection against contact for electrical units as required by the VDE [Association of Ger- man Electrical Engineers]..

If your appliance malfunctions or if fractures, cracks or splits appear:

-switch off all cooking zones;

-disconnect the hob from the mains supply; and

-contact your local service centre..

If the cooktop cracks, turn the appliance off to avoid the possibility of electric shock. Do not use your hob until the glass surface has been replaced..

Do not use the hob to heat aluminium foil, products wrapped in aluminium foil or frozen foods packaged in aluminium cookware..

Child safety

This appliance is not intended for use by young children or infirm persons without the adequate supervision of a responsible adult.

Young children should be supervised to ensure that they do not play with the appliance..

The cooking zones will become hot when you cook.. Always keep small children away from the appliance..
